38 /**
39 * ADSR Envelope Generator
40 *
41 * Envelope Generator with stage 'Attack', 'Attack_Hold', 'Decay_1',
42 * 'Decay_2', 'Sustain' and 'Release' for modulating arbitrary synthesis
43 * parameters.
44 */
45 class EGADSR {
46 public:
47 enum stage_t {
48 stage_attack,
49 stage_attack_hold,
50 stage_decay1,
51 stage_decay2,
52 stage_sustain,
53 stage_release,
54 stage_fadeout,
55 stage_end
56 };
57
58 EGADSR(gig::Engine* pEngine, Event::destination_t ModulationDestination);
59 void Process(uint TotalSamples, RTList<Event>* pEvents, RTList<Event>::Iterator itTriggerEvent, double SamplePos, double CurrentPitch, RTList<Event>::Iterator itKillEvent = RTList<Event>::Iterator());
60 void Trigger(uint PreAttack, double AttackTime, bool HoldAttack, long LoopStart, double Decay1Time, double Decay2Time, bool InfiniteSustain, uint SustainLevel, double ReleaseTime, uint Delay);
61 inline EGADSR::stage_t GetStage() { return Stage; }
62 protected:
63 gig::Engine* pEngine;
64 Event::destination_t ModulationDestination;
65 uint TriggerDelay; ///< number of sample points triggering should be delayed
66 float Level;
67 stage_t Stage;
68 float AttackCoeff;
69 long AttackStepsLeft; ///< number of sample points til end of attack stage
70 bool HoldAttack;
71 long LoopStart;
72 float Decay1Coeff;
73 long Decay1StepsLeft; ///< number of sample points in Decay1 stage
74 float Decay2Coeff;
75 bool InfiniteSustain;
76 float SustainLevel;
77 float ReleaseCoeff;
78 long ReleaseStepsLeft; ///< number of sample points til end of release stage
79 bool ReleasePostponed; ///< If a "release" event occured in the previous audio fragment, but wasn't processed yet.
80 const static float FadeOutCoeff;
81 private:
82 static float CalculateFadeOutCoeff();
83 };
